From Facebook to Meta: A Strategic Shift
The decision to rebrand from Facebook to Meta marked a pivotal moment in the company’s history. It signaled a strategic shift towards building a metaverse, a virtual reality universe where people can work, play, and socialize. This ambitious vision involves creating immersive experiences through augmented reality (AR), virtual reality (VR), and other technologies.
The rebranding was driven by several factors. Firstly, it aimed to diversify the company’s revenue streams beyond advertising, which has been the primary source of income for years. Secondly, it reflected a desire to position Meta as a pioneer in the emerging field of the metaverse, a space with immense potential for growth.
Business Model
Meta’s core business model revolves around connecting people and generating advertising revenue. The company’s flagship platforms, Facebook, Instagram, WhatsApp, and Messenger, boast billions of active users, providing a massive audience for advertisers.
While advertising remains the primary revenue driver, Meta is diversifying its income streams. The company is investing heavily in virtual reality and augmented reality hardware, such as the Oculus Quest headset, to drive growth in the metaverse. Additionally, Meta is exploring other opportunities, including e-commerce, payments, and subscriptions.

Challenges and Opportunities
Meta operates in a highly competitive and rapidly evolving landscape. Some of the key challenges the company faces include:
- Competition: The rise of platforms like TikTok and Snapchat has intensified competition for user attention and advertising dollars.
- Privacy Concerns: Growing concerns about data privacy and security have led to increased regulatory scrutiny and consumer backlash.
- Content Moderation: The platform has faced criticism for its handling of harmful content, such as hate speech and misinformation.
- Economic Uncertainty: Economic downturns can impact advertising spending, affecting Meta’s revenue.
Despite these challenges, Meta also has significant opportunities:
- Metaverse Potential: The metaverse represents a vast untapped market with the potential to generate substantial revenue.
- Artificial Intelligence: Meta is investing heavily in AI, which can be used to enhance its products and services.
- International Expansion: The company has significant growth opportunities in emerging markets.
- New Revenue Streams: Diversifying revenue streams beyond advertising can reduce reliance on a single source of income.
